Furutech has announced the release of their limited edition ultra-high-end performance DPS-4 power cable (off-the-reel); consisting of a revolutionary new copper technology called α (Alpha) OCC‐DUCC.

Alpha OCC-DUCC is constructed using a combination of DUCC (Dia Ultra Crystallized Copper) and Furutech?s world-famous Pure Transmission α (Alpha) OCC (Ohno Continuous Casting) copper.

Furutech α OCC-DUCC ? supplied and regulated with strict quality control by Mitsubishi Materials Industries (MMI) ? is one of the best conductors Furutech engineers have found for signal transmission and sound reproduction. MMI is the leading manufacturer of the highest-purity oxygen-free copper in the world. MMI processes this extremely pure oxygen-free copper with a new technology that optimally aligns the crystals while reducing the number of crystal-grain boundaries, resulting in a tremendously efficient conductor.

Other ultra-pure copper cable types, for example OFC (Oxygen-Free Copper) and PCOCC (Perfect Crystal Ohno Continuous Casting), are about maximizing the length of the crystals in one dimension and improving the purity of the conductor to eliminate the so-called ?diode distortion? generated during a signal's transition between neighboring crystals. Straight OCC copper benefits are thus its larger ?fibrous? crystals and creating as few crystal junctions as possible. OCC copper is however sensitive to directionality, i.e. one path exhibits the least resistance. Furutech?s world famous Pure Transmission α-OCC is the result of further processing of OCC with their Alpha Super Cryogenic and Demagnetizing treatment.

MMI's research has however shown that impurities still arise inside the crystals of OCC copper; and not just at the contact areas. Their DUCC process goes a significant step further and involves re-crystallization of the copper during which pollutants are released and removed. MMI has thus managed to design their new DUCC conductor to optimally align the copper crystal grain structure in addition to reducing crystal grain boundaries. As a result, DUCC copper is less sensitive to directionality than OCC and also far more superior.

The design of the DPS-4 power cable is intriguingly sophisticated:

Each of its three cores is constructed of three layers of conductors - wires, differing in number, direction of winding and material they are made of. The inner bundle consists of 79 Alpha-OCC wires with a 0.18 mm2 gauge each, twisted to the right. The next layer is wound onto it, made of 37 DUCC (7N) wires with a 0.18 mm2 gauge each and twisted left; and finally on top of these two, there is another core with 42 DUCC (7N) copper wires with a 0.18 mm2 gauge each and twisted to the right. The final bundle has a diameter of 2.75 mm2. The overall cable diameter is 17mm.
